The Palestinian Center For Human Rights (PCHR): On Friday evening, a Palestinian child lost his left eye after being directly shot with a rubber bullet during Israeli occupation forces (IOF) attacks on protestors near al-Ram village’s northern intersection, north of occupied East Jerusalem.

This attack comes 3 days after the Palestinian Child Day, which is observed on April 5th every year and reflects IOF’s grave violations against Palestinian children in the occupied Palestinian territory (oPt).

According to investigations conducted by the Palestinian Centre for Human Rights, at approximately 22:00 on Friday, 08 April 2022, dozens of Palestinian young men and boys gathered near the northern intersection of al-Ram village, north of occupied East Jerusalem, and some of them threw stones and Molotov Cocktails at a military watchtower and military vehicles stationed there.

Afterward, IOF immediately assaulted the protestors and opened heavy fire with live and rubber bullets at them. As a result, Mohammed Eyad Mousa Motawer (17) sustained a rubber bullet in his left eye while present -along with other children- 15 meters away from the Israeli soldiers. Motawer was then taken to Ramallah Governmental Hospital for treatment.

The child’s family stated to PCHR’s fieldworker that Mohammed was directly shot in his left eye, as the rubber bullet penetrated his eye. The family added that he underwent several surgeries and medical crews at the hospital was forced to remove his eye. The boy had sustained wounds in his right eye 10 year ago; hence, he is now severely visually impaired.

It should be noted that this is not the first incident of IOF attacking peaceful Palestinian protestors and deliberately wounding them in their eyes causing loss of sight among civilians, nor is it the first incident of IOF targeted attacks on protestors’ upper bodies.

This attack is only one incident in a series of IOF attacks that have been escalating since the beginning of Ramadan, including attacks on Palestinian gatherings in the Bab al-‘Amoud area, one of occupied East Jerusalem’s Old City gates, within a systematic policy by the occupation to suppress any Palestinian presence in the area.

So far, dozens of protestors sustained wounds and bruises, and more than 40 others were arrested in IOF’s escalated attacks in Jerusalem.

So far in 2022, IOF killed 20 Palestinians, including 5 children, and wounded 184 others, including 39 children, in separate incidents in the West Bank; most of those killed and wounded were killed due to IOF excessive use of force against peaceful protests and gatherings.
